What is floodplain and why What is floodplain and why is it important?is it important?

Floodplain - the lowland adjacent to a river, Floodplain - the lowland adjacent to a river, lake or ocean.  lake or ocean.  

Floodplains are designated by the frequency of Floodplains are designated by the frequency of the flood that is large enough to cover them.the flood that is large enough to cover them.

The National Flood Insurance Program has The National Flood Insurance Program has established a minimum standard of protection established a minimum standard of protection against the 100-year flood. against the 100-year flood.

Flood damage reduction – critical interestFlood damage reduction – critical interest

Conceptual ProcessConceptual Process1.1. Rainfall input Rainfall input

2.2. Topologic dataset of the Topologic dataset of the watershed of Waller Creekwatershed of Waller Creek

3.3. Runoff Simulation by using Runoff Simulation by using HEC-HMSHEC-HMS

4.4. Calculation of water Calculation of water surface-elevations along the surface-elevations along the channel with HEC-RASchannel with HEC-RAS

5.5. Transformation of water-Transformation of water-surface elevation to a surface elevation to a unique inundation area unique inundation area known as flood plain known as flood plain
